Block 666907

9c0a9e5145882916a0c3faa012c54d4639128805dcee09e3eeebf1c7ecec9618
Transactions1
Height666907
Confirmations4935898
TimestampTue, 14 Apr 2015 23:26:48 UTC
Size (bytes)239
Version2
Merkle Root876309f217e6cb31bcb6ed05cd187131091dd717b59bc4a78da7559a26557fdd
Nonce327447
Bits1c316e83
Difficulty5.178785357865509

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
4935898 Confirmations80 FTC